The Busbar by Welden is crafted using galvanized steel or aluminum. Its design ensures high performance across various applications.
Manufactured through stamping and sheet processing, it suits energy storage systems, machinery, and electric vehicles. The surface is polished for durability and a clean finish.
The busbar is made with precision, using laser cutting and bending methods. It maintains a tolerance of ±0.10mm with thicknesses ranging from 2 to 4 mm.
Certified under ISO9001:2015, the busbar complies with GB, EN, and TEMA standards. With a production capacity of 50,000 pieces monthly, delivery is assured in 7 days.
